As Vice President of Public Housing, Charlton Hamer provides leadership and oversight for all public housing clients. Habitat's public portfolio consists of 6,100 units located in Chicago, Illinois and St. Louis, Missouri. Charlton's experience spans development and both asset and property management. His focus on top-level operations sets the stage for portfolio growth in the public housing market. Before rejoining The Habitat Company, Mr. Hamer has served in several leadership roles at real estate firms like Redstone Urban Properties, LLC; VESTA Corporation and Shore Area Community Development Corporation. Professionally, Mr. Hamer is a member of the Urban Land Institute, the American Planning Association and the University of Illinois Alumni Association. In addition he served as the chairman of the Bridgeport, Connecticut Redevelopment Agency. Mr. Hamer holds a Master of Urban Planning and Policy degree from the University of Illinois at Chicago and a Bachelor of Arts in Urban Planning degree from the University of Illinois at Champaign-Urbana. He is a licensed real estate broker in the State of New York.
